Patents by Inventor Matthew E. Broomhall

Matthew E. Broomhall has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210110110
    Abstract: Interleaved conversation concept flow enhancement can include detecting a topic of an on-going conversation over an electronic communication system. In response to detecting a topic newly introduced into the on-going conversation, a topic-divergence metric (TDM) with respect to the original topic and the newly introduced topic can be determined. A topic-divergence response action can be initiated in response to the newly introduced topic diverging from the original topic by more than a predetermined threshold based on the TDM.
    Type: Application
    Filed: December 22, 2020
    Publication date: April 15, 2021
    Inventors: Paul R. Bastide, Fang Lu,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20210103381
    Abstract: A method, system and computer program product for displaying content without obscuring key details on a computer screen. After the computing system detects the display of overlapping application windows, objects in the application windows are detected using an object recognition service. A determination is then made as to which of these detected objects correspond to objects that are being focused by the user, will be focused by the user and/or have been focused by the user based on the tracking of the eye gaze of the user and/or prior recorded patterns of activity. A score may then be generated for each of these focused objects indicating a level of obstruction using the location of the focused objects, the location of overlays and/or prior recorded patterns of activity. An optimal layout of the overlapped application windows is determined in response to the score for the focused object(s) exceeding a threshold value.
    Type: Application
    Filed: December 17, 2020
    Publication date: April 8,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Patent number: 10972860
    Abstract: A system and method for responding to changes in social traffic in a geographic area receives, via an electronic communications interface, information describing a geographic area and one or more attributes of people expected to be in the geographic area. A geofence is defined based on the information describing the geographic area, and a cohort of people expected to be in the geofence is defined based on the one or more attributes. Information from a sensor regarding an attribute of a person at a geographic location is received via an electronic communications network. Based on the attribute, a determination is made whether or not the person is a member of the cohort of people expected to be in the geofence. An alert may be triggered based at least in part on whether or not the person is a member of the cohort of people expected to be in the geofence.
    Type: Grant
    Filed: May 25, 2017
    Date of Patent: April 6,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Fang Lu
  • Patent number: 10956115
    Abstract: A method, computer system, and a computer program product for intelligently synchronizing exercise music for an instructor based group workout is provided. The present invention may include identifying at least one goal workout. The present invention may then include receiving a plurality of verbal cues associated with an instructor and a plurality of nonverbal cues associated with the instructor. The present invention may also include analyzing the received plurality of verbal cues and the received plurality of nonverbal cues. The present invention may further include generating the exercise music based on the analyzed plurality of verbal cues and analyzed plurality of nonverbal cues.
    Type: Grant
    Filed: August 22, 2018
    Date of Patent: March 23,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Fang Lu
  • Publication number: 20210083998
    Abstract: Machine logic rules for adding, or recommending to add, recipients for an e-message based at least in part upon historical data relating to e-message distribution and content; machine logic rules for add adding, or recommending to add, text to an e-message based at least in part upon historical data relating to e-message distribution and content; and/or machine logic rules for responding to (for example, replying, forwarding), or recommending to respond to, an e-message based at least in part upon historical data relating to e-message distribution and content. Historical data relating to e-message distribution and content may be structured in the form of graphs with nodes and connections among and between the nodes.
    Type: Application
    Filed: September 12, 2019
    Publication date: March 18,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Patent number: 10951566
    Abstract: According to one embodiment of the present invention, a system processes messages and includes at least one processor. The system receives a message intended for a collection of messages having a common topic. The message is compared to the common topic of the collection of messages to determine relatedness of the message to the collection of messages. The presentation of the message is altered based on the comparing. Embodiments of the present invention further include a method and computer program product for processing messages in substantially the same manner described above.
    Type: Grant
    Filed: November 10, 2017
    Date of Patent: March 16,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Thomas J. Evans, IV, Robert E. Loredo
  • Patent number: 10949779
    Abstract: Balancing a workload based on commitments to projects includes monitoring messages in a collaboration system, the messages representing correspondences between users of the collaboration system, selecting a number of the users associated with the collaboration system to form a group of users, retrieving the messages from each of the users in the group of users, analyzing data associated with the messages to determine which of the messages relate to at least one project, and executing, based on a threshold, at least one action to optimize a workload for at least one user in the group of users for the at least one project.
    Type: Grant
    Filed: November 20, 2018
    Date of Patent: March 16,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Dale M. Schultz, Shunguo Yan
  • Patent number: 10936174
    Abstract: A method, system and computer program product for displaying content without obscuring key details on a computer screen. After the computing system detects the display of overlapping application windows, objects in the application windows are detected using an object recognition service. A determination is then made as to which of these detected objects correspond to objects that are being focused by the user, will be focused by the user and/or have been focused by the user based on the tracking of the eye gaze of the user and/or prior recorded patterns of activity. A score may then be generated for each of these focused objects indicating a level of obstruction using the location of the focused objects, the location of overlays and/or prior recorded patterns of activity. An optimal layout of the overlapped application windows is determined in response to the score for the focused object(s) exceeding a threshold value.
    Type: Grant
    Filed: May 9, 2018
    Date of Patent: March 2,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20210056172
    Abstract: Interleaved conversation concept flow enhancement can include detecting a topic of an on-going conversation over an electronic communication system. In response to detecting a topic newly introduced into the on-going conversation, a topic-divergence metric (TDM) with respect to the original topic and the newly introduced topic can be determined. A topic-divergence response action can be initiated in response to the newly introduced topic diverging from the original topic by more than a predetermined threshold based on the TDM.
    Type: Application
    Filed: August 21, 2019
    Publication date: February 25, 2021
    Inventors: Paul R. Bastide, Fang Lu, Robert E. Loredo, Matthew E. Broomhall
  • Patent number: 10929489
    Abstract: A method, system and computer program product for improving the discoverability of messages on a social network. The creation of a proposed message that requests a response from a target audience is detected. The social network is then searched to identify search terms and posts related to the proposed message. Upon identifying the search terms, the search terms are ranked in order of usage among the identified posts. A list of identified search terms in order of rank is then presented to the user to modify the proposed message. The proposed message is modified using a search term selected by the user from the list of search terms. The modified message is then posted on the social network. In this manner, the message created by the user has been modified to improve the discoverability of the message on the social network and to increase responses from an appropriate target audience.
    Type: Grant
    Filed: January 11, 2019
    Date of Patent: February 23,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Thomas J. Evans, IV, Robert E. Loredo
  • Publication number: 20210050002
    Abstract: Structured conversation enhancement can include determining an anticipated ebb point of a current conversation. The determination can be made in response to a predetermined triggering event indicating a start of the current conversation. Structured conversation enhancement also can include monitoring the current conversation using pattern recognition. A probable change in the anticipated ebb point can be determined in response to recognizing a predetermined word pattern indicating a change in the conversation. A response action can be initiated in response to the probable change in the anticipated ebb point.
    Type: Application
    Filed: August 13, 2019
    Publication date: February 18, 2021
    Inventors: Paul R. Bastide, Fang Lu, Robert E. Loredo, Matthew E. Broomhall
  • Patent number: 10924586
    Abstract: Aggregating virtual reality (VR) sessions includes supporting a plurality of requests for a VR session. Further, aggregating VR sessions includes determining a similarity between a first VR request and a second VR request. Still further, aggregating VR sessions includes merging a first VR environment supporting the first VR request and a second VR environment supporting the second VR request.
    Type: Grant
    Filed: May 30, 2018
    Date of Patent: February 16,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Lin Sun, Liam S. Harpur, Matthew E. Broomhall
  • Publication number: 20210042677
    Abstract: A computer-implemented method for evaluating team effectiveness and acting on one or more outliers based on the evaluated team effectiveness. The method retrieves electronic data of one or more users, wherein the electronic data comprises a plurality of electronic communications. The method further extracts one or more concepts and metadata from the retrieved electronic data. The method further determines one or more outliers based on the extracted one or more concepts and metadata, wherein the determined one or more outliers are based on one or more poorly connected concepts and one or more poorly connected users. The method further acts on the determined one or more outliers and displays a report based on the determined one or more outliers.
    Type: Application
    Filed: August 6, 2019
    Publication date: February 11, 2021
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20210028887
    Abstract: A method, computer system, and a computer program product for recasting repetitive messages is provided. Embodiments may include receiving, by a processor, a message. Embodiments may include determining, by the processor, whether the received message is repetitive. Embodiments may include rating, by the processor, an importance level of the received message. Embodiments may include determining a preference for recasting the received message.
    Type: Application
    Filed: July 22, 2019
    Publication date: January 28, 2021
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o
  • Patent number: 10904199
    Abstract: A plurality of electronic messages communicated to a recipient can be analyzed to determine, for each of the electronic messages, an amount of time that will be saved for a sender of the electronic message by the recipient performing at least one activity corresponding to the electronic message. The electronic messages can be presented to the recipient in a manner that indicates, for each of the electronic messages, the determined amount of time that will be saved for the sender of the electronic message by the recipient performing the at least one activity corresponding to the electronic message.
    Type: Grant
    Filed: July 27, 2018
    Date of Patent: January 26,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Paul R. Bastide, Liam S. Harpur, Matthew E. Broomhall, Lin Sun
  • Patent number: 10902074
    Abstract: Related post identification and presentation is described. A system includes an interface to receive a base post generated by an author. An analyzer analyzes the base post and a number of other posts. A search engine of the system identifies from the number of other posts and based on the analysis, a number of related posts that relate to the base post. A posting engine of the system presents the base post along with identified related posts in an activity stream of a subscriber.
    Type: Grant
    Filed: June 14, 2018
    Date of Patent: January 26,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Matthew E. Broomhall, Paul R. Bastide, Lin Sun, Liam S. Harpur
  • Publication number: 20210011954
    Abstract: Document discrepancy determination and mitigation can include marking a fragment of a first document and a corresponding fragment of a second document in response to determining a dependency between the first document and the second document. A discrepancy probability with respect to the first document and the second document can be identified based on a discrepancy measure, which can be determined by comparing the marking of the fragment of the first document and the marking of the corresponding fragment of the second document. One or more discrepancy mitigation procedures can be initiated in response to the discrepancy measure exceeding a predetermined threshold.
    Type: Application
    Filed: July 11, 2019
    Publication date: January 14, 2021
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o
  • Patent number: 10887263
    Abstract: A method for creating at least one new thread associated with an online conversation is provided. The method may include monitoring the online conversation to detect a new or updated element of the online conversation. The method may also include extracting the detected new or updated element. The method may further include analyzing the online conversation and the extracted detected new or updated element to determine if a new online conversation has started. The method may include extracting a plurality of members associated with the online conversation. The method may also include extracting a plurality of content associated with the extracted detected new or updated element. The method additionally include prompting a user to determine if a new online conversation should be created. The method may also include creating the new online conversation. The method may further include notifying the plurality of extracted members about the created new online conversation.
    Type: Grant
    Filed: June 25, 2018
    Date of Patent: January 5, 2021
    Assignee: International Business Machines Corporation
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o, Dale M. Schultz
  • Publication number: 20200410029
    Abstract: A method, computer system, and a computer program product for recommending additional content to an author generating authored content is provided. The present invention may include monitoring a travel location associated with the author. The present invention may include calculating a multi-sensory region based on the travel location and a maximum sense distance value. The present invention may include selecting at least one piece of additional content from a corpus of additional content based on the multi-sensory region. The present invention may include generating a model based on the at least one piece of additional content. The present invention may include selecting a relevant piece of additional content from the data model based on determining a topic associated with the relevant piece of additional content matches an authored topic associated with the authored content. The present invention may include presenting the selected relevant piece of additional content to the author.
    Type: Application
    Filed: June 26, 2019
    Publication date: December 31, 2020
    Inventors: Paul R. Bastide, Robert E. Loredo, Matthew E. Broomhall
  • Publication number: 20200401636
    Abstract: The method, computer program product and computer system may include computing device which may collect message data containing one or more metadata tags from one or more collaboration and social media communication networks. The computing device may load the message data into a datastore. The computing device may determine the utility of the one or more metadata tags contained within the message data. The computing device may determine the effectiveness of the one or more metadata tags contained within the message data. The computing device may combine the calculated frequency and the calculated information gain of the one or more metadata tags using regression analysis and may activate a metadata tag management routine for the one or more metadata tags if the combined frequency and information gain falls below a threshold value.
    Type: Application
    Filed: June 18, 2019
    Publication date: December 24, 2020
    Inventors: Paul R. Bastide, Matthew E. Broomhall, Robert E. Loredo